About the Lenoir County District Court

The Lenoir County District Court is a mid-sized trial court serving Lenoir County in North Carolina. Located at 130 S. Queen St., Kinston, NC 28501, the court operates with 3 judges and handles misdemeanor criminal offenses, civil infractions, traffic violations, small claims disputes, and landlord-tenant matters. Serves Lenoir County in eastern NC. Kinston has gained national attention for its culinary scene and the revitalization of its downtown. North Carolina trial courts serve as the entry point to the court system for most residents, processing the highest volume of cases of any court level.
